WGU C215 Operations Management PVDC Final Exam Questions and Answers Graded A

WGU C215 Operations Management

PVDC Final Exam Questions and

Answers Graded A

Which definition is used for quality, evaluates how well a product performs its intended function?

✔✔Fitness for use

14 points for quality improvement ✔✔Which total quality management (TQM) process was

developed to stress management's responsibility for quality?

ISO 9000 ✔✔Set of international standards on quality management and quality assurance, critical

to international business

-TQM process consists of 13 published standards and guidelines

-Like when joint commission shows up at the hospitals

Checklist ✔✔A list of common defects and the number of observed occurrences of these defects.

scatter diagram ✔✔a plot of two variables showing whether they are related

Control Chart ✔✔A graph that shows whether a sample of data falls within the common or normal

range of variation.

mean ✔✔A statistical measure of central tendency, or average, based on dividing a total by the

number of individual cases.

assignable causes of variation ✔✔-Causes can be identified and eliminated

-e.g. poor employee training, worn tool, machine needing repair


common causes or random ✔✔Stuff you cannot identify

-Random causes that we cannot identify, unavoidable

Cpk measures ✔✔How close one is to a target and how consistent one is with the average

performance.

center of gravity approach ✔✔an approach for locating a single facility that minimizes the distance

to existing facilities.

-use the breakeven analysis -how many units needed to manufacture to breakeven.

break-even analysis ✔✔the process of determining the number of units a firm must sell to cover

all costs. Considers fixed costs, variable costs.eg Fed EX is in Tennessee so it will be in the middle

repetitive process ✔✔classic assembly line. A line process, a continuous process.

Project Process ✔✔make a one-at-a-time product exactly to customer specifications, expensive.

Like an automobile collision shop that does body and engine repair as well as custom vehicle paint

job.

Batch Process ✔✔a process in which goods or services are produced in groups (batches) and not

in a continuous stream eg. auto shop offers body repair, engine repair, and custom vehicle paint

options
